The Additive Prognostic Value of Lipoprotein(a) for All-cause and Cardiovascular Mortality Across the Traditional Cardiovascular Risk Continuum: Analysis from NHANES III (1988-1994) with Follow-Up to 2019.

INTRODUCTION: Lp(a) is an independent risk factor for a variety of cardiovascular (CV) outcomes. However, it remains unclear whether its prognostic value differs between individuals with varying baseline traditional CV risk. This study aims to evalua…
